Ottawa Parliament Hill: A Journey Through Time and Culture

Ottawa Parliament Hill, the heart of Canadian democracy, stands as a symbol of the nation's history, culture, and architectural grandeur. Located in the capital city of Ottawa, this stunning complex is home to the Houses of Parliament, where pivotal decisions are made, shaping the future of Canada.

Constructed in the Gothic Revival style, the Parliament buildings are not just functional spaces; they are masterpieces of art and history. The most prominent structure is the Centre Block, featuring the iconic Peace Tower that rises 92 meters high, providing breathtaking views of the Ottawa skyline and the river beyond. This architectural marvel was completed in 1927, replacing the original building that was destroyed by fire in 1916.

As you stroll around the grounds, the meticulously maintained gardens and historical monuments provide further context to Canada's past. The Peace Tower, for instance, houses a carillon, a set of bells that play a lovely melody on the hour, emphasizing the tranquility of the surroundings amidst political activity.

Another highlight of Ottawa Parliament Hill is the Changing of the Guard ceremony, a tradition that dates back to the 19th century. Visitors can observe this ceremonial display during summer months, where the Governor General’s Foot Guards perform a parade filled with precision and regality, showcasing Canada's military history.
